Re: Репликация MySQL с двух master серверов
От: Anton Batenev Россия https://github.com/abbat
Дата: 13.06.13 15:40
Оценка:
Здравствуйте, maks1180, Вы писали:

m> Необходимо настроить slave сервер MySQL, что-бы он реплицировал данные одновременно с двух master MySQL серверов. На master серверах имена БД не пересекаются.


Напрямую так сделать нельзя, варианты:

* Поднять 2 инстанса для slave на одном физическом сервере;
* Сделать один из мастеров промежуточной репликой M1->M2->S (при этом на M2 хранить данные не обязательно — можно поменять тип таблиц на BLACKHOLE — нужны будут только бинлоги;
* Сделать мульти-мастер репликацию (кольцо);
* Сделать мастера репликами друг-друга, а slave периодически переключать между ними (ИМХО, самый извращенный способ).
avalon/1.0.433
 
Подождите ...
Wait...
Пока на собственное сообщение не было ответов, его можно удалить.